Gab*_*che 8 controls button flutter flutter-layout
我如何创建类似的东西?:
我知道颤振有
CupertinoSegmentedControl()
Run Code Online (Sandbox Code Playgroud)
但这会创建类似于标签的东西,没有什么像里面有按钮的开关那样滑动。
Aid*_*all 22
我发现的最好的事情是CupertinoSlidingSegmentedControl():
class _ViewState extends State<View> {
int segmentedControlGroupValue = 0;
final Map<int, Widget> myTabs = const <int, Widget>{
0: Text("Item 1"),
1: Text("Item 2")
};
@override
Widget build(BuildContext context) {
return Scaffold(
body: CupertinoSlidingSegmentedControl(
groupValue: segmentedControlGroupValue,
children: myTabs,
onValueChanged: (i) {
setState(() {
segmentedControlGroupValue = i;
});
}),
);
}
}
Run Code Online (Sandbox Code Playgroud)
希望这可以帮助。请参阅此处的文档。
| 归档时间: |
|
| 查看次数: |
7538 次 |
| 最近记录: |